Effective Skin Enhancement

When it comes to vitamin E, we must mention its effective skincare benefits. Alpha-tocopherol is an active ingredient that keeps the skin healthy and vibrant. Vitamin E also strengthens the level of Alpha-tocopherol, the most abundant fat-soluble antioxidant in the skin. Furthermore, vitamin E helps prevent the harmful effects of UV rays, reduces swelling, and combats skin inflammation.

Balances Hormones in Women

Vitamin E has the ability to balance hormones in the body. Some symptoms of hormonal imbalance, such as irregular menstruation, allergies, unusual skin changes, and constant fatigue, can be alleviated with vitamin E. It helps restore hormonal balance and energy levels in the body.

Relieves Joint Pain

If you’re wondering about the benefits of taking vitamin E, one of them is effective relief from joint pain. Numerous studies have demonstrated that vitamin E effectively reduces joint pain. Vitamin E reduces oxidative stress on muscles after exercise, improving physical endurance. Moreover, it enhances blood circulation and effectively nourishes muscle cells.

Supports Heart Disease Prevention

Vitamin E is considered a valuable aid in preventing heart disease. Many studies have shown that vitamin E reduces the risk of heart attacks by up to 20% in individuals with heart disease. This benefit is maximized when vitamin E is used alone without other antioxidants.

Furthermore, vitamin E can prevent the oxidation of cholesterol. Oxidized cholesterol can be harmful to health, so supplementing with vitamin E helps maintain stable cholesterol levels.

So now you have the answer to the question, “What are the benefits of taking vitamin E?” These are the wonderful effects of vitamin E on the human body. However, it’s essential to use vitamin E properly and in the right dosage to avoid unwanted side effects.
